Eine von Facebook entwickelte JavaScript-Bibliothek zur Erstellung von Benutzeroberflächen (Frontends).
React ist unsere erste Wahl für die Entwicklung moderner, interaktiver Benutzeroberflächen (Frontends). Der Kern von React ist das Konzept der Komponenten: Man baut die Oberfläche aus kleinen, wiederverwendbaren Bausteinen zusammen. Eine Navigationsleiste, ein Button, ein Suchfeld – alles sind eigenständige Komponenten.
Dieser Ansatz macht den Code nicht nur übersichtlich und wartbar, sondern ermöglicht auch die Entwicklung hochperformanter 'Single-Page Applications' (SPAs), die sich so flüssig anfühlen wie eine Desktop-Anwendung. React ist das Herzstück vieler der von uns entwickelten Webapplikationen.
jsx
// Eine einfache React-Komponente für die BINARY one Website.
// React ist unsere Kerntechnologie für moderne Frontends.
import React from 'react';
function WelcomeBanner({ companyName }) {
return <h1>Willkommen bei {companyName}!</h1>;
}
function App() {
return <WelcomeBanner companyName="BINARY one" />;
}